BEIJING, Sept. 10 (InfoChina) – In spite of sharp rises recently, CITIC Securities still gives a “buy” rating on the A-share of China Eastern Airlines (NYSE: CEA, HK: 0670, SH: 600115), given that the carrier would benefit from enhanced operational efficiency and capital injection from SIA and Temasek amid recovery of the domestic aviation industry.
CITIC predicts EPS of China Eastern from 2007 to 2010 would be 0.13, 0.23, 0.44 and 0.63 yuan respectively with annual compound growth rate at 68 percent, and its PE till 2009 would be 35 times with rational price at 15.5 yuan and the highest price at 20 yuan.
CITIC predicts that aviation industry would keep growth till 2010.
China Eastern A-share closed at 17.02 yuan on the latest trading day on Sept. 7. Its trading was suspended Monday. (Edited by Lin Fanjing,
